WebAlso through the trunk twisting the body and leg workspace of the quadruped robot are increased. The mathematical model of kinematics and inner relationship between body and leg workspace and the twisting angle are analyzed in the paper. The increased body and leg workspace will help to increase the stability margins and locomotion speed. WebA one-minute torso twist burns about four calories. If you add 5 lbs. of resistance to a trunk rotation, such as a medicine ball, cable machine or elastic bands, you can burn about 10 calories per minute. You can also boost the intensity and calorie burn by doing a trunk rotation on an exercise ball. These numbers don’t reflect the extra ... Look at your hands, and as you exhale, carefully twist your torso, keeping your arms straight and bringing your body back … WebMay 15, 2024 · Generally the wire being allowed to grow into the trunk is a bad idea, with a few exceptions. Fusion bonsai only works with certain rapidly growing species, Ficus, Trident maples, and a a few others, but not everything. Old fashioned wire, let grow, remove wire, wire again, let grow, etc is the main way to get twisted trunks.
